What people believe — religious affiliation and those with no religion.
More than half of people in Kergunyah South report having no religion, making it a place where secularism is far more common than in most other areas. This trend is stark, with 55.3% of residents identifying as non-religious, well above the figures for both Victoria and Australia.
The mix of religions, and people with no religion.
At 55.3%, the share of people with no religion is far above the Victorian figure of 39.3%. Other religious groups are less common, with Christianity accounting for 22.4% and Judaism for 3.9% of the population.
